The problem was: CVS N.Y. wanted records from a medical technician school. I wrote them, that it was not a nursing school . I did not finish it anyway ( 20 years ago.....).

So I was afraid when I checked my status online and noticed that they were still waiting for that stuff....

I called them and everything was fine at that time: "Ready for Review" and they told me that the status needs to be updated.

The only thing I have to do now is to wait for the reviewer to send me something and the board to send me the letter of approval ( hopefully).
